The Tampa Bay Buccaneers could not be more excited to get the 2020 NFL season started. After making the huge move to sign Tom Brady in the offseason, the offense is expected to be lethal. With targets like Mike Evans, Chris Godwin, and Rob Gronkowski, Brady is going to be very happy.

It has been a long time since Brady had the kind of weapons that he will have this year. He is already looking great and Evans could not be more excited to work with him.

During a recent quote shared by ESPN’s Jenna Laine, Evans gave a glowing first impression of his new quarterback.

“Already up there as of my favorite teammates even though we’ve only had a few practices together. He’s trying to turn me into a living legend as well.”

Evans has worked with Jameis Winston throughout his career. That alone would make the leap to Brady a big step in the right direction. Brady is a much more accurate quarterback and will make life much easier on his wide receivers.

During the 2019 season with the Buccaneers, Evans once again proved that he is an elite NFL wide receiver. He racked up 67 receptions for 1,157 yards and eight touchdowns. Those numbers came despite the fact that he missed three games.

At just 26 years old, the sky is the limit for Mike Evans with Brady. Even with the quarterback being 43 years old, he still has plenty of good football left in him. The Buccaneers strongly believe that Brady can lead them back to Super Bowl contention.

Expect to see the offense play a very exciting brand of football. Tom Brady can’t sling the football deep like he used to, but Evans gives him exactly the kind of weapon that he needs. The Buccaneers are going to be a threat this season.
